Working Plan: Pathogenic microbes that invade a human host have developed sophisticated strategies to rewire host-signaling pathways and down-regulate host immune responses. Bacterial pathogens use a plethora of secreted effectors and cell-associated proteins to achieve this goal during infection.
The HUBs project aims to illuminate how pathogen-encoded proteins hijack host cells from an integrative structural biophysics perspective. Within this framework, we offer an opportunity to dissect the complex structural dynamic facets of a prominent effector produced by life-threatening human pathogens. To this end, the selected candidate will be engaged in protein expression and purification and experimental and computational approaches, receiving training small-angle scattering, and NMR hybrid applications.
